Choosing Your Perfect Pellet Mill: What to Consider
With so many great options, how do you pick the right one for your business? Start by asking yourself three key questions: What materials will you be processing most? What's your typical daily throughput? And where will the machine be located? If you're focusing on circuit board recycling equipment, the EcoPellet Pro-DS 500 or AridTech PelletMaster might be your best bet. For large-scale plastic processing, the SmartPellet M2000 Dry or MegaPellet DryMax 1500 will serve you well. And if portability is key, the CompactGran DS 300 or UltraCompact DryPro400 are hard to beat.
Remember, the best machine isn't just the one with the highest capacity or the flashiest features—it's the one that fits your unique needs, budget, and long-term goals.
